WebMethod 2: Create a rule based on the website name. Even without a password manager you can still get away with only needing to remember 1 password - all you need is a simple rule that will slightly change your password to make it unique each time. First make sure you have a strong base password - use one of the password ideas on the previous ... WebStrong Password Ideas and Examples . Make sure you use at minimum fifteen characters.
